How to Fix ‘White Screen of Death on Windows 10 PC’ Issue – Guide
Sometimes, a minor failure can result in the White Screen of Death error, so performing a new reboot can resolve this bug. Just be sure to disconnect all USB drives and look for the faulty drive while connecting them separately one by one. Faulty device driver, incorrect cumulative updates, or third-party applications can also lead to similar WSOD errors. Repairing obsolete applications using system restore point can diagnose the problem as well. Let’s explore these workarounds in detail.
Restart your computer by force
If the white screen of death is displayed up instead of the normal Windows login page, you should force the device to reboot. press and hold the button button for a few minutes. Once the computer shuts down, click the power button button again and restart the system.
Disconnect USB devices
If the above method didn’t help you get rid of the White Screen of Death, you should check if any of the USB devices connected to your PC isn’t causing the problem. Unplug your USB mouse, keyboard, hard drives or other devices that are connected to your PC.
Then force the computer to restart and turn it on again. If the white screen disappears, reconnect the devices one by one to see which one caused the problems.
